Steven D. Snyder
January 24, 1951 - November 28, 2019

Steven Dale Snyder, 68, passed away Thanksgiving Day, November 28, 2019, at his home in Houston, Texas.

Steve was born in Harris County, Houston, Texas, January 24, 1951, and was adopted by his parents, Robert H. Snyder and Barbara E. Dunham Snyder. He was a devoted son and brother as well as a true son of Texas. He graduated from Texas A&M University at College Station, Texas, May 4, 1973. Steve’s professional life was in the mechanical division of several major companies as a Mechanical Specialist focusing on the oil and gas processing industry and was involved in world travel in that business.

He also loved the great outdoors, was an avid hunter, camper, and conservationist. Additionally, Steve loved car racing and was the SCCA National Champion for his class in 2008. He was also involved in the cook-offs at the Houston Fat Stock Show and Rodeo for many years. He had any friends and his steadfast friendship to all will always be remembered.

His world was shared with his sister and brother, two nephews, four nieces, cousins, friends and relatives. Wanting to understand his origin, Steve searched for and found his biological mother, Barbara Boutte. He developed a close and understanding relationship with Barbara for many years

Steve was dedicated and very close to his adopted father, mother and grandmother who were the source of his sense of humor and generosity. He was also in the Boy Scouts of America for many years.
